Tìm hiểu về số nguyên tố
Số nguyên tố là gì?Số nguyên tố là số tự nhiên lớn hơn 1 không thể được hình thành bằng cách nhân hai số tự nhiên nhỏ hơn. Số tự nhiên lớn hơn 1 không phải là số nguyên tố được gọi là hợp số. Ví dụ: 5 là số nguyên tố bởi vì cách duy nhất để viết nó dưới dạng một tích, 1 × 5 hoặc 5 × 1, có số hạng là chính số 5.
Để có thể viết chương trình kiểm tra số nguyên tố bạn có thể tìm hiểu về thuật toán số nguyên tố.
Sau đây là chương trình kiểm tra số nguyên tố sử dụng lập trình C
#include <stdio.h>Kết quả của chương trình:
#include <math.h>
int main(){
int n;
printf("\nNhap n = ");
scanf("%d", &n);
if(n < 2){
printf("\n%d khong phai so nguyen to", n);
return 0;
}
int count = 0;
for(int i = 2; i <= sqrt(n); i++){
if(n % i == 0){
count++;
}
}
if(count == 0){
printf("\n%d la so nguyen to", n);
}else{
printf("\n%d khong phai so nguyen to", n);
}
}
No comments:
Post a Comment